Assessment and Accreditation Officer, Education Dean's Office

Job Summary:
This position will sustain overall assessment, accreditation, and reporting for the School of Education (SOE). They will be essential for the quality assurance of programs and depicting the SOE to the university and outside agencies.

Minimum Qualifications:
  • Bachelor’s Degree in a field that is related to Education, Statistics, Business Administration, Computer Science
  • 3+ years of work experience in research and data analysis
  • Strong ability to interpret and analyze assessment data.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ills
  • Ability to work independently and with others in a positive and effective manner
  • Proficiency with database, spreadsheet, and word processing software
  • Demonstrated problem-solving and organizational skills
  • Must be detail oriented; possess analytical skills and statistical ability to translate raw data from disparate sources into information and knowledge
  • Ability to travel via car and air

Desired Qualifications:
  • An understanding of accreditation for education programs in higher education settings at local, state, and national levels
  • Proficiency with web-based assessment systems
  • Successful experience in the area of accreditation/continuous improvement in a higher education setting.
  • Advanced knowledge of Banner, Microsoft Office Suite, Adobe Acrobat, Hyland OnBase, and electronic survey software​
